The Goal of the
B612* Foundation is... |
|
To significantly
alter the orbit of an asteroid, in a controlled manner, by 2015. |
|
|
|
- Asteroid
and comet impacts have both destroyed and shaped life on Earth
since it formed.
- The
Earth orbits the Sun in a vast swarm of near Earth asteroids (NEAs).
-
The probability of an unacceptable collision in this century
is ~2%.
-
We now have the capability to anticipate an impact and to prevent
it.
* B612 is the asteroid home of the Little Prince in Antoine de Saint-Exupery's child's story The Little Prince.

We've been anticipating the
conclusion of a contract we issued to Jet Propulsion Laboratory in early 2008,
and it's now available. We asked JPL to analyze, in detail, the performance of
a transponder equipped gravity tractor (t-GT) in determining the precise orbit
of a NEO with which it has rendezvoused, and to evaluate the towing performance
of the GT per se. This, and other interesting findings are now in and available on
